Roof mount support masts
Barker & Williamson's roof mount mast
systems, together with our broadband end-fed antennas, give base units the HF
communications capability needed in today's environment.
This mast system comes with a versatile foot for attachment to
a flat, pitched, or peaked roof.
Mast poles are made in 4 foot sections.
They are field assembled with an inner joiner, and bolted together.
Extra long guy lines are supplied, and lines run down to appropriate tie offs.
A halyard and pulley allow pulling up the antenna afterwards.
The material utilized for the pole sections
is a composite known as FRP - fiberglass reinforced plastic. Unlike cheap
"fishing pole" material it is extremely lightweight, strong, and rigid.
The color is throughout the material - no chipping paint. Also,
shock hazards are eliminated.

These mast kits are
designed to support our BWD / BWDS or AC / ACS broadband
antennas. They may also be
used to support most any wire dipole antenna.
These kits have 4 Ft
mast sections which are bolted together - no pins or lanyards on
these models. All mast tops
have a halyard pulley. Kits
DO NOT include carry bags. |

Specifications:
- Height
Up to 24 Ft
- Guy
Spread
Half the height
- Guy
Tension
5 - 10 Lbs
- Halyard Tension 40
lbs max
- Downward Press Up to 25 Lbs
depending upon guys, halyards, and wind
- Wind
Loading
12Ft @ 50 MPH is approx 10 Lbs sideways
-
24Ft @ 50 MPH is approx 20 Lbs sideways
- Weight
12 Ft Mast weighs 5 Lbs, approx 10 Lbs for complete kit
-
24 Ft Mast weighs 10 Lbs, approx 17 Lbs for complete kit
